    AT3G17440.1

    Model type
    Protein coding
    Short Description
    novel plant snare 13
    Curator Summary
    member of NPSN Gene Family
    Computational Description
    novel plant snare 13 (NPSN13); FUNCTIONS IN: molecular_function unknown; LOCATED IN: plasma membrane; EXPRESSED IN: 25 plant structures; EXPRESSED DURING: 15 growth stages; CONTAINS InterPro DOMAIN/s: Target SNARE coiled-coil domain (InterPro:IPR000727); BEST Arabidopsis thaliana protein match is: novel plant snare 12 (TAIR:AT1G48240.1); Has 481 Blast hits to 465 proteins in 133 species: Archae - 4; Bacteria - 38; Metazoa - 112; Fungi - 19; Plants - 145; Viruses - 0; Other Eukaryotes - 163 (source: NCBI BLink).
